How they compare

Greece currently reports 20 1000 USD against 13 1000 USD in Australia, a difference of 7 1000 USD.

That makes Greece's figure about 1.5 times Australia's.

The two have swapped places 3 times across 6 shared years of data; in 2009 it was Greece ahead.

Australia ranks 54th and Greece ranks 51st of 62 countries.

Greece has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

The database contains data on the bilateral trade flows in roundwood, prim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world. The main types of primary forest products included in are: ro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further. The definitions are available.
